Though salary details aren’t published, the role is temporary, running from January to April 2026, with the possibility of a contract extension for top performers.
Day-to-Day Responsibilities
Your main focus will be answering incoming calls about registration renewals and offering guidance to members. Attention to detail is key, as you’ll input notes and complete reports about technical issues. Proficiency with tools like Excel, Outlook, and more is required. You’ll also handle follow-up emails and assist with information searches on the organization’s website. Any other relevant tasks may be assigned by your supervisor, ensuring variety in your workdays.

Potential Cons
The role demands comfort during extended phone sessions, as shifts can last up to seven hours per day. If you’re not fully fluent in French, the language requirement may pose a challenge. Since the job is temporary, there’s no long-term guarantee unless your contract is extended. Some users could find the work repetitive or demanding depending on call volume.
